Septic tank and septic system services in Paducah typically range from $300 to $1,500, with an average cost around $700. Prices can fluctuate based on the size of the tank, the frequency of pumping, and the complexity of repairs needed.
Local septic service providers charge between $150 to $300 for inspections and $200 to $500 for repairs. It’s advisable to check with the Paducah Public Works Department for any local regulations on septic systems and disposal practices.
When comparing quotes for septic services in Paducah, ensure you are comparing similar services, such as pumping frequency and types of inspections. Look for detailed estimates to understand what is included.
Licensed septic service contractors in Paducah charge $75–$150/hr depending on the task and their expertise. Complex repairs may require specialized labor, affecting costs.
Most septic system work in Paducah requires permits from the Paducah Public Works Department. This ensures compliance with local health regulations, which can affect project timelines.
Choosing high-quality materials for repairs can add 10–20% to the overall service cost. Quality parts may enhance the longevity and efficiency of your septic system.
Septic system services are often in higher demand during spring and fall, as homeowners prepare for seasonal changes. Scheduling during off-peak months may result in better rates.
Using household products with a septic system in Paducah requires caution. Many common household cleaners, bleach, and antibacterial soaps can disrupt the natural bacteria in your septic tank, which are essential for breaking down waste. Opt for septic-safe products that are designed to be gentle on the system. Additionally, avoid flushing items like wipes, feminine products, and chemicals that can cause clogs or damage. Being mindful of what goes into your septic system can help maintain its health and efficiency, and consulting with a local septic expert can provide further guidance.
In Paducah, it's generally recommended to pump your septic tank every 3 to 5 years, depending on household size and usage. Regular pumping helps prevent clogs and system failures, which can lead to costly repairs and health hazards. Larger households may require more frequent pumping, while smaller homes may get by with longer intervals. Additionally, if you notice slow drains or backups, it may be time for an inspection and pumping. Consulting with a local septic service provider can help you establish the right schedule for your system based on your specific needs.
Signs of a failing septic system in Paducah can include slow drains, gurgling toilets, unpleasant odors near the tank or drain field, and pooling water in your yard. If you notice these issues, it’s crucial to contact a septic service professional immediately, as ignoring them can lead to more severe problems and costly repairs.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ent failures, ensuring your system operates efficiently. Local professionals can provide guidance on troubleshooting and maintaining your septic system to avoid emergencies.
The lifespan of a septic system in Paducah can be influenced by several factors, including the quality of installation, regular maintenance, and household usage. Systems that are well-designed and installed by experienced professionals tend to last longer. Regular pumping and inspections are crucial to identify potential issues before they become major problems. Additionally, heavy water usage or introducing harmful chemicals can shorten the lifespan of your system. Adhering to proper maintenance schedules and being mindful of what you flush down the drains are essential to prolonging the life of your septic system.
If your septic tank is overflowing in Paducah, it's essential to act quickly to prevent damage to your property and potential health risks. First, avoid using water in your home to minimize further strain on the system. Contact a local septic service provider immediately to assess the situation and perform emergency pumping if necessary. They can also inspect the system for underlying issues that may have caused the overflow.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ent such emergencies, so consider scheduling routine service to keep your septic system in good working order.
